Scout Driscoll is the founder and CEO of VINT, Wine Branding & Design. With a firm belief in storytelling through design, VINT expertly guides wine brands through strategic branding and packaging evolutions. VINT has designed more than 100 wine labels for Cooper’s Hawk Winery & Restaurants, helping them build the nation’s largest wine club (with 400,000+ members) with a wine program that includes VINT-designed collaborations with John Charles Boisset’s Raymond and DeLoach Vineyards, Dr. Loosen, Francis Ford Coppola Winery, Ste. Michelle Wine Estates, and John Legend’s LVE Wines. VINT has been honored with awards from the Harper’s Design Competition and is proud of its commitment to female-founded companies. VINT is 100% woman-owned and operated.

Driscoll also leads VINT’s parent company, DesignScout, a Chicago-based branding agency. For nearly 20 years, DesignScout has been dedicated to uplifting entrepreneurs by building authentic and honest brands, collaborating with more than 200 clients in myriad industries. DesignScout is particularly renowned for its work with food and beverage clients to create personality-rich, Instagram-worthy brands.
